    What is Dr. Derek Johnson's specialty?

    Dr. Johnson is a Pediatric Allergist & Immunologist near Fairfax, VA. A Pediatric Allergist & Immunologist is a physician who specializes in diagnosing and treating allergies, asthma, and immune system disorders in infants, children, and adolescents. These specialists address conditions such as food allergies, eczema, hay fever, allergic reactions, primary immunodeficiencies, and autoimmune diseases, providing comprehensive care tailored to the unique needs of younger patients.     Is this Dr. Derek Johnson affiliated with a ranked Castle Connolly Top Hospital?

    Yes, Dr. Johnson is affiliated with Reston Hospital Center which is a Castle Connolly Top Hospital.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ise. The list recognizes hospitals that excel in 20 or more specific medical procedures, representing the top 25% nationwide.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als
